Role Overview
We are hiring a professional Automotive Route Delivery Driver responsible for a structured daily B2B route across the Okanagan.
This role is built for experienced people who already understand:
- automotive shops
- dealership operations
- structured business delivery routes
You will also be responsible for repairing and restoring equipment functionality as part of the route.
Core Responsibilities
- Operate a company cargo van on a structured daily B2B route
- Deliver and pick up automotive products, and equipment
- Work directly with dealership and shop personnel (technicians, service advisors, parts teams)
- Provide strong, consistent customer service at every stop
- Manage inventory accuracy and stock control on route
- Diagnose, repair, and fully restore equipment functionality in the warehouse or on-site
- Ensure equipment is operational before leaving customer locations
- Complete accurate mobile/tablet reporting (deliveries, inventory, repairs)
- Maintain long-term professional relationships across assigned accounts
